Danish Culture and Understanding – week 5 (January 30-February 3, 2012)
'Danish Culture and Understanding' is an interdisciplinary course, taking place in week 5, 2012 for exchange students attending Metropolitan University College. The academic content consists of extracts from the general curriculum for the basic Danish programmes, revolving around the evolution of the Danish social model, Danish culture and intercultural communication.
The course provides a solid foundation for understanding your own studies in a Danish context. In addition, a number of social activities are planned for the week. Please find the preliminary program here.
The course is free and you are welcome to attend even if the week is not included in your Learning Agreement or Training Agreement.
